Tag Archives | WebServices

jsonenvio

REST JSON y Java

REST JSON son dos acrónimos que cada día se usan más. Estamos ya muy acostumbrados a recibir datos JSON en nuestras aplicaciones AJAX y HTML5 desde el servidor. De hecho  se ha convertido en un standard de facto.   REST JSON y Envío Aunque es cierto que esta forma de trabajar la tenemos ya muy […]

005

Android REST y AsyncTask

Una de las tareas mas habituales que tenemos que hacer cuando programamos aplicaciones Android es acceder a información ubicada de forma remota. Esta operación se suele realizar a traves de  una petición Android REST. Al principio todo parece muy sencillo sin embargo cuando nos ponemos a programarlo las cosas se pueden complicar un poco ¿Porque? […]

001

Servicios REST (@FormParam,@PathParam)

En JEE el conjunto de anotaciones para REST  es amplio .Voy a comentar a continuación varias de las mas utilizadas cuando creamos servicios de este tipo. @FormParam :Esta anotación es una anotación a nivel de parámetro y sirve para ligar parámetros de un formulario HTML con variables del servicio REST . @PathParam: Esta anotación es una […]

001

Apache CXF y REST (Configuración)

En este post vamos a configurar Apache CXF para que sea capaz de publicar un servicio web REST . Para ello necesitaremos realizar varias operaciones . En primer lugar modificar el fichero web.xml para añadir el servlet de Apache CXF y los listener de Spring .Ya que recordemos Apache CXF se apoya de manera fuerte […]

001

JAX-RS Servicios RESTFull en Java

Vamos a construir un servicio REST utilizando los estandares de JAX-RS . Para ello lo primero que tenemos que hacer es comenzar a conocer las distintas anotaciones que el estandar define. @GET :Esta anotación marca un método y define  una operación GET  .Es similar a cuando realizamos una petición HTTP GET y solo debe usarse […]

002

Introducción a Servicios REST

Cada día necesitamos mas usar servicios web REST . Estos servicios se diferencian de una forma importante de los servicios web SOAP con los que hemos trabajado . REST (Representational State Transfer) es un estilo de arquitectura para desarrollar servicios. Los servicios web que siguen este estilo deben cumplir con las siguientes premisas. Cliente/Servidor : […]